Спасибо, что приглядываете — но беспокоиться не нужно: харнесс сожмёт контекст автоматически, и работа продолжится без потерь. А вот что действительно важно перед сжатием — чтобы всё долговременное лежало в памяти, а не в контексте. Обновлю снимок состояния:
Снимок состояния сохранён. Теперь по существу вашего наблюдения — два уровня защиты:
- Контекст этой сессии — харнесс сжимает его автоматически: когда разговор станет слишком длинным, старая часть свернётся в резюме, и я продолжу работу без вашего участия. Завершать сессию из-за этого не нужно.
- Долговременная память — всё стратегическое уже лежит в файлах, которые я читаю в начале каждой сессии: приоритеты и решения, свежий снимок «что влито в main» (только что обновил), особенности вашей машины (Rancher/testcontainers, токены), принцип делегирования рутины дешёвым моделям. Новая сессия — хоть завтра, хоть через месяц — начнёт с полным пониманием, где мы.
Так что практическая рекомендация: для следующей крупной задачи (POST /api/games или позиционная аналитика) действительно стоит открыть свежую сессию — не из-за риска потерь, а потому что чистый контекст для большой работы эффективнее сжатого. Мелочи можно продолжать и здесь.
Сегодняшний день, если коротко: движок стал Maven-артефактом и источником истины на всех платформах → Scala-бэкенд с нуля до read-паритета с тестами → вся фаза 1 UI (SvelteKit, движок, тесты реконструкции, фильтры) с тремя найденными по дороге продакшн-багами → уборка: метки на шести репозиториях, labeler, маршрутизация моделей. Около двадцати влитых PR. Очень продуктивная сессия — отличная точка, чтобы поставить паузу.